Description of πŸ‘¦ Farmer Jack Rubber Boot for Little Boys by Hatley

Rubber. Fabric lining. Pull-On closure. Hand Wash. Rain boot in tractor motif featuring soft jersey lining and pull-on handles. Logo on shaft.

Excellent "disposable " children's boots.

My son only wears rubber boots. It makes sense to be in Seattle, it gets very wet here. But due to his fondness for boots, they tend to wear out badly. This is our third pair of Hatleys for him - each pair has lasted 10 months. It doesn't seem like much time, but they're worn every day, everywhere, and 3-year-olds don't skimp on things.
